Cost of Porch Drainage Repair in Napa
Maintaining a well-functioning porch drainage system is crucial for homeowners in Napa, CA, to prevent water damage and ensure the longevity of their property. The cost of porch drainage repair can vary widely based on several factors. Understanding these variables can help homeowners budget effectively for necessary repairs.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Extent of Damage: The severity of the drainage issue often dictates the overall cost. Minor repairs will be less expensive than extensive overhauls.
- Type of Drainage System: Different systems, such as French drains or channel drains, have varying installation and repair costs.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Napa, CA, can significantly impact the total cost, as skilled labor is often required for proper drainage repair.
- Materials Used: The quality and type of materials used for the repair, such as piping and gravel, can influence the overall expense.
- Accessibility: Easy-to-access drainage systems are typically less costly to repair than those in hard-to-reach areas.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
- Weather Conditions: Napa's weather can affect both the urgency and the complexity of the repair, potentially increasing costs during rainy seasons.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Napa, CA) |
---|---|
Minor Drainage Repair | $200 - $500 |
Installation of French Drain |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Channel Drain Installation | $1,500 - $4,000 |
Regrading for Drainage | $1,000 - $2,500 |
Sump Pump Installation | $1,500 - $3,500 |
Downspout Extension | $100 - $300 |
Drainage System Inspection | $100 - $250 |
